147 Saddle Ln, Waverly, WV 26184
Meredith Manor, a sprawling 153-acre property in Waverly, West Virginia, presents a unique redevelopment opportunity. This expansive estate boasts a 4,511 sq ft main house featuring 3 bedrooms, 2.5 baths, an eat-in kitchen, dining room, office, gym, and a 4-car garage with 2 RV garages. Beyond the main residence lies a substantial complex ideal for hospitality or equestrian uses. The property includes 100 beds distributed across a main dorm (requiring approximately $45,000 in roof and interior repairs), a secondary dorm, and 10 modified shipping containers equipped for housing. Operational support buildings include a cafeteria with a commercial kitchen (100-person capacity), an administrative office with multiple private offices and a viewing room, and an additional office trailer. Extensive equestrian facilities are a key feature, encompassing 150 stables, 9 equipped barns (including farrier and therapy spaces), and 7 indoor arenas totaling approximately 3.8 acres. The property also includes multiple storage sheds, city water and gas, and an on-site sewage plant. Five commercial generators are on-site, though one is inoperable. Access is convenient via three entrances from SR 31S and two from Love Hill Rd. The property's proximity to Parkersburg offers additional advantages. Two additional parcels are available for purchase separately: an 85-acre parcel (partially cleared) for $200,000 and a 2-acre parcel ($350,000) including a well-equipped mechanic shop and paint shop. The asking price for Meredith Manor is $1,600,000. The property is zoned commercial and offers significant potential for various income-generating ventures.
